Solution for 4x^2+x-3x-6x^2= equation:


Simplifying
4x2 + x + -3x + -6x2 = 0

Reorder the terms:
x + -3x + 4x2 + -6x2 = 0

Combine like terms: x + -3x = -2x
-2x + 4x2 + -6x2 = 0

Combine like terms: 4x2 + -6x2 = -2x2
-2x + -2x2 = 0

Solving
-2x + -2x2 = 0

Solving for variable 'x'.

Factor out the Greatest Common Factor (GCF), '-2x'.
-2x(1 + x) = 0

Ignore the factor -2.

Subproblem 1

Set the factor 'x'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ying x = 0 Solving x = 0 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Simplifying x = 0

Subproblem 2

Set the factor '(1 + x)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ying 1 + x = 0 Solving 1 + x = 0 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-1' to each side of the equation. 1 + -1 + x = 0 + -1 Combine like terms: 1 + -1 = 0 0 + x = 0 + -1 x = 0 + -1 Combine like terms: 0 + -1 = -1 x = -1 Simplifying x = -1

Solution

x = {0, -1}
